Bill Bradley believes that the Lakers play with some of the same qualities that helped the Knicks win the NBA title in 1970 and 1973.

Bradley was a teammate of Los Angeles coach Phil Jackson with New York in the 1970s.

"Phil gets players to play unselfishly," Bradley said. "He gets people to help each other. He gets people to start thinking, 'How can I help my teammate help the team?' "
